Aggregate

VAR_SAMP

MySQLMySQL

Menghitung varians sampel dari nilai-nilai numerik. Menggunakan pembagi N-1 (koreksi Bessel) untuk estimasi yang tidak bias.

Tipe hasil: DOUBLEDiperbarui: 7 Jan 2026

Syntax

SQL
VAR_SAMP(expr)

Parameter

exprnumericwajib

Ekspresi numerik untuk menghitung varians sampel

Contoh Penggunaan

Varians Sampel

SQL
1SELECT VAR_SAMP(test_score) AS score_variance
2FROM sample_students;

Menghitung varians dari sampel nilai siswa.

Hasil
score_variance: 349.69

VAR_SAMP untuk Survey

SQL
1SELECT question_id,
2 VAR_SAMP(rating) AS rating_variance
3FROM survey_responses
4GROUP BY question_id;

Mengukur variasi jawaban survey per pertanyaan.

Hasil
Q1: 1.44, Q2: 0.64, Q3: 2.25

Confidence Interval

SQL
1SELECT
2 AVG(value) AS mean,
3 VAR_SAMP(value) AS variance,
4 VAR_SAMP(value) / COUNT(*) AS variance_of_mean
5FROM experiment_data;

Menghitung komponen untuk interval kepercayaan.

Hasil
mean: 45.2, variance: 100, variance_of_mean: 4.41